Abstract
This paper introduces a definition of the instantaneous frequency (IF) on real signals. Basically the definition ωt = xt /√1 − x2t avoids some pitfalls associated with the corresponding definition on analytic signals. It readily applies to the class of monocomponent frequency modulated signals and also accommodates the class of amplitude and frequency modulated signals. An interpretation of the IF is given for the latter and an extension of it to instantaneous parameters is discussed.
